Same ballpark build time and cost for a fire truck in Australia or New Zealand.
A bushfire tanker is a bit cheaper, an urban pumper costs a bit more. All based on off the shelf^ European or Japanese truck chassis.
The lead time from order to delivery is more like 18 months, but 6 weeks is pretty typical for the actual build time.
^ Not quite “off the shelf” in that commercial trucks tend to be built to order, crew cabs especially, but they’re not entirely bespoke beasts like North American appliances.
